1 in binario: guida completa alla lettura, conversione e applicazioni

Nel mondo della informatica e dell’elettronica, il concetto di 1 in binario è una chiave di lettura fondamentale. Questo articolo approfondisce cosa significa davvero “1 in binario”, come si ottiene, come si interpreta e quali sono le applicazioni pratiche più comuni. Se vuoi capire da dove nasce il sistema binario e come si trasformano i numeri tra decimale e binario, sei nel posto giusto: una lettura fluida, ma anche ricca di dettagli tecnici, esempi chiari e strumenti utili.
Cos’è 1 in binario e perché importa
1 in binario rappresenta la base del sistema di numerazione binario, usato da computer e dispositivi digitali per codificare informazioni. A differenza del nostro sistema decimale, che si fonda su dieci cifre (0-9), il binario si limita alle due cifre 0 e 1. Ogni cifra binaria è una potenza di due, e la combinazione di queste potenze permette di rappresentare qualsiasi numero. Il fatto che tutto in hardware sia effettivamente una sequenza di stati acceso/spento è la ragione per cui 1 in binario è una pietra miliare: è l’unità di misura di una logica semplice ma potentissima.
Perché il sistema binario è al centro dell’informatica
Il motivo è pratico: i circuiti elettronici hanno due stati distinti, che possono essere interpretati come acceso (1) o spento (0). Questa chiarezza consente segnali affidabili, riducendo errori e rumore. La rappresentazione binaria permette inoltre di eseguire operazioni logiche e aritmetiche in modo rapido e proporzionalmente affidabile. Da qui nasce l’importanza di comprendere 1 in binario: è la porta di accesso a concetti come memorizzazione, elaborazione, codifica e comunicazione digitale.
Come si legge 1 in binario: principi base
In binario, ogni posizione rappresenta una potenza di due. A destra, le cifre hanno potenze di due crescenti da 2^0, 2^1, 2^2, e così via. Per leggere una sequenza, si sommano i valori delle posizioni in cui compare 1. Ad esempio, la stringa binaria 1011 corrisponde a 2^3 + 2^1 + 2^0 = 8 + 2 + 1 = 11 in decimale. Quando si incontra la cifra 1 al centro di una stringa, si sta semplicemente includendo quella potenza di due nella somma totale. Così, 1 in binario non è altro che una nuova forma di esprimere numeri, ma con una logica tradizionalmente diversa dal decimale.
1 in binario: definizione pratica e uso quotidiano
La definizione pratica di 1 in binario è semplice: è la sequenza che, letta da destra verso sinistra, indica quali potenze di due sono presenti. Nell’insieme, questa logica consente a un computer di memorizzare letteralmente dati, istruzioni e segnali. Ogni bit può essere combinato con altri bit per formare parole binarie, byte, word e registri all’interno di una CPU. In breve, 1 in binario è l’elemento costitutivo minimo di informazioni digitali: una sola cifra, ma già determinante nel contesto dell’elaborazione.
Metodi di conversione: come passare da decimale a binario
Esistono diversi metodi per ottenere la rappresentazione binaria di un numero. I due più comuni sono la divisione ripetuta per 2 e l’uso di tabelle di potenze di due. Vediamo come applicarli passo-passo, con esempi concreti di 1 in binario e numeri vicini.
Metodo della divisione per 2
Questo metodo consiste nel dividere ripetutamente il numero per 2 e registrare il resto. I resti, letti al contrario, formano la rappresentazione binaria. Ecco la procedura:
- Prendi un numero decimale da convertire.
- Dividilo per 2, annotando il resto (0 o 1).
- Divideria nuovamente il quoziente ottenuto, annotando i resti, finché il quoziente non diventa zero.
- La sequenza dei resti letta al contrario è la rappresentazione binaria.
Esempio pratico: convertiamo 13 in binario. Divisioni successive: 13 / 2 = 6 resto 1; 6 / 2 = 3 resto 0; 3 / 2 = 1 resto 1; 1 / 2 = 0 resto 1. Lettura al contrario: 1101. Quindi 13 in binario è 1101. Per quanto riguarda 1 in binario, la rappresentazione è semplicemente 1.
Rappresentazione di 1 in binario con i bit
Rappresentare 1 in binario con un certo numero di bit è utile per controllare lo spazio di memoria o visualizzare formati fissi. Ad esempio, in 4 bit, 1 in binario si esprime come 0001; in 8 bit, come 00000001. Questo è fondamentale per concetti come riempimento di byte, allineamento e strutture dati. La differenza tra 1 in binario e 0001 è puramente di formattazione, non di contenuto numerico.
Conversione binario-decimale: come leggere 1 in binario
Convertire una stringa binaria in decimale è altrettanto importante. Si usa la somma delle potenze di due dove la cifra è 1. L’operazione è diretta e non richiede strumenti complessi. Per leggere 1 in binario, basta identificare la posizione in cui è presente 1. Se la stringa è 1, il valore decimale è 1. Se la stringa contiene più bit, come 1010, si sommano le potenze corrispondenti: 2^3 + 2^1 = 8 + 2 = 10.
Metodologia del valore numerico
La regola è semplice: assegnare a ogni posizione, partendo da destra, una potenza di due crescente. Moltiplica per 1 la potenza corrispondente e somma. Esempio: 1101 in binario corrisponde a 2^3 + 2^2 + 2^0 = 8 + 4 + 1 = 13 decimali. Per 1 in binario, la cifra in posizione 0 vale 2^0 = 1, quindi il valore decimale è 1.
Numeri negativi e binario: come gestirli
Quando si lavora con numeri negativi, il sistema binario diventa più complesso. Esistono diverse rappresentazioni, tra cui complemento a due, complemento a uno e formati segnato/unsigned. La più diffusa è il complemento a due, che permette di fare sottrazioni direttamente con operazioni binarie. L’esempio classico: rappresentare -1 usando 8 bit è 11111111, perché l’inverso di 00000001 (1) e poi si aggiunge 1 ottiene 11111111. Per capire 1 in binario come parte di numeri negativi, è utile esercitarsi con esempi di complemento a due e di gestione del overflow.
Complemento a due: principi di base
Nel complemento a due, si inverte ogni bit della rappresentazione assoluta di un numero e si aggiunge 1. Per ottenere la versione binaria di un numero negativo, si parte dal valore positivo, si esegue l’inversione dei bit e si aggiunge 1. Questo metodo consente di eseguire somma e sottrazione utilizzando la stessa logica di hardware. Ad esempio, con 8 bit, -5 si ottiene invertendo 00000101 in 11111010 e aggiungendo 1 si ottiene 11111011. La cifra 1 in binario resta 00000001 nel positivo, ma in contesto di complemento a due può partecipare ad operazioni che coinvolgono numeri negativi.
Applicazioni pratiche di 1 in binario
La conoscenza di 1 in binario trova applicazione in vari campi: dalla programmazione all’elettronica, dalla crittografia alle reti di calcolo parallelo. Di seguito alcuni ambiti chiave dove la rappresentazione binaria è imprescindibile.
Memoria e architettura dei computer
Ogni dato in un computer è memorizzato come sequenze di bit. Una bit indica lo stato acceso/spento, due bit creano una combinazione di quattro stati, e così via. La comprensione di 1 in binario è essenziale per interpretare come i costrutti al livello di linguaggio macchina si trasformano in istruzioni eseguibili. Le memorie cache, i registri e le interfacce di I/O si basano su formati binari e su segmenti di bit che hanno significato preciso.
Programmazione: conversione e manipolazione di bit
In molti linguaggi di programmazione, operazioni sui bit permettono di controllare segnali, ottimizzare prestazioni e gestire protocollo di comunicazione. Esempi comuni includono shift a sinistra o a destra, mask di bit e test di specifiche posizioni. Imparare a manipolare 1 in binario è un passo fondamentale per chi lavora con sistemi embedded, grafica computazionale o algoritmi a livello di bit.
Elettronica e sistemi digitali
Nel campo dell’elettronica digitale, i numeri binari determinano lo stato di registri, flip-flop e circuiti logici. La rappresentazione binaria è visibile anche in processi di codifica come NRZ (Non-Return-to-Zero) e in combinatori logici semplici. Capire 1 in binario permette di decodificare segnali, analizzare schemi e progettare logiche complesse. In breve: la conoscenza della rappresentazione binaria è la chiave per tradurre idee astratte in circuiti concreti.
Esecuzioni pratiche: esempi concreti di codici
Per rendere più chiaro l’uso di 1 in binario, ecco alcuni esempi pratici di conversione e di interpretazione in contesti reali. Ogni caso mostra come una semplice cifra, come 1, si integri in sequenze più ampie di bit e come la gestione delle cifre binarie influenzi i calcoli e le memorie.
Esempio 1: conversione decimale-binaria di numeri vicini a 1
Decimale: 1
Binario: 1
Decimale: 2
Binario: 10
Decimale: 3
Binario: 11
Nella tabella, si osserva che 1 in binario è la base, mentre numeri vicini hanno rappresentazioni che aggiungono cifre a sinistra. Questo schema è fondamentale per comprendere i concetti di bit, byte e word in sistemi digitali.
Esempio 2: operazioni logiche con 1 in binario
1 in binario (8-bit): 00000001
NOT(1 in binario): 11111110
AND con 1 in binario: 00000001
OR con 1 in binario: 00000001
XOR con 1 in binario: 00000000
Questo esempio illustra come la singola cifra 1 possa influenzare operazioni logiche. In sistemi numerici reali, operazioni simili sono alla base di algoritmi crittografici, di controllo degli errori e di protocolli di comunicazione.
Strumenti utili per imparare 1 in binario
Se vuoi praticare e affinare la tua comprensione di 1 in binario, esistono strumenti utili: convertitori online, simulazioni di CPU, ambienti di sviluppo integrati con editor bit e moduli didattici. Ecco alcune risorse pratiche:
- Convertitori decimale-binario online per testare rapidamente esempi come 1 in binario e numeri correlati.
- Simulazioni di porte logiche che mostrano come la cifra 1 interagisce in circuiti logici semplici.
- Ambientazioni di programmazione che includono esercizi di manipolazione di bit, utile per comprendere 1 in binario e la sua utilità.
Guida rapida ai formati durante la pratica
Un rapido promemoria utilissimo quando si lavora con 1 in binario è la gestione di formati di dati: bit, byte, word e registri; come si allineano e come si effettuano conversioni tra formati. Un’obiettivo chiaro è capire come 1 in binario possa essere la base per codifiche di caratteri (ASCII), immagini (bitmap) e suoni (campionamenti), dove la dimensione e l’organizzazione dei dati dipendono dal tipo di formato scelto.
Errori comuni da evitare
Tra gli ostacoli frequenti ci sono confusione tra potenze di due, errore di posizionamento delle cifre e mancata considerazione del numero di bit disponibile. Esempi comuni includono:
- Confondere 1 in binario con la cifra 1 in una stringa di bit che non ha la stessa lunghezza (es. 1 vs 0001 o 00000001).
- Dimenticare che la lettura binaria avviene da destra verso sinistra quando si sommano le potenze di due.
- Non considerare l’overflow quando si lavora con un numero limitato di bit (ad esempio 8-bit vs 16-bit).
Domande frequenti su 1 in Binario
Di seguito rispondo ad alcune delle domande più comuni che spesso sorgono dagli studenti e dai professionisti che si avvicinano al tema.
1 in binario e i sistemi a base 2 hanno lo stesso significato?
In breve sì: 1 in binario è una cifra all’interno di un sistema a base 2. Il valore assoluto dipende dalla posizione della cifra all’interno della sequenza di bit. Una singola cifra 1 in una posizione particolare indica una specifica potenza di due, e la somma di tali potenze fornisce il numero decimale corrispondente.
Qual è la differenza tra 1 in binario e 1 in decimale?
La differenza sta nel modo in cui la cifra è mediata. 1 in binario è una rappresentazione in base 2; 1 in decimale è la rappresentazione in base 10. Entrambe indicano lo stesso valore numerico, ma il modo in cui si esprime è diverso. Comprendere questa differenza è essenziale per convertire tra i due sistemi senza errori.
Come si calcolano le potenze di due necessarie per leggere 1 in binario?
Le potenze di due si calcolano come 2^0, 2^1, 2^2, ecc. Per leggere la cifra 1 in una posizione specifica, basta individuare la potenza di due associata a quella posizione. Ad esempio, in una stringa binaria di otto bit, la posizione più a destra è 2^0, quella successiva è 2^1 e così via. Se in una certa posizione c’è 1, si aggiunge quella potenza al totale.
Conclusione: perché studiare 1 in binario è utile
Studiare 1 in binario non è solo una curiosità teorica. È una chiave pratica per lavorare efficacemente con hardware, software e sistemi informatici moderni. La conoscenza della rappresentazione binaria facilita la comprensione di come i dati vengono archiviati, elaborati e trasmessi. Inoltre, fornisce una solida base per argomenti avanzati, come l’architettura di computer, i protocolli di rete, la programmazione a basso livello e la progettazione di algoritmi che operano direttamente sui bit.
Riassunto e prossimi passi
In questa guida abbiamo esplorato cosa significhi 1 in Binario, come si legge, come si converte tra decimale e binario, come rappresentare numeri negativi e quali sono le applicazioni pratiche. Se vuoi approfondire ulteriormente, prova a eseguire conversioni di numeri casuali tra decimale e binario, sperimenta con kit di sviluppo e strumenti di simulazione, e crea piccoli progetti che utilizzino operazioni bitwise. La pratica costante è la chiave per padroneggiare 1 in binario e, di conseguenza, per acquisire una comprensione più solida della logica digitale e della programmazione.
Appendice: risorse pratiche per l’apprendimento
Per chi desidera un percorso di studio più strutturato, ecco una mini-checklist di risorse utili:
- Guide introduttive al sistema binario e al concetto di bit e byte.
- Esercizi guidati di conversione decimale-binario e binario-decimale.
- Tutorial su operazioni bitwise in linguaggi comuni come Python, JavaScript, C/C++.
- Schemi e grafici che illustrano come 1 in binario si inserisce in formati dati e memorie.